Wizards' Jamir Watkins: Five swipes in SL finale
Watkins tallied 23 points (8-18 FG, 4-11 3Pt, 3-4 FT), eight rebounds, two assists and five steals across 34 minutes during Saturday's 94-85 Summer League win against the Knicks.
Watkins was a menace defensively once again, as he led the way with a game-high total in the steals category. The Florida State product came two swipes shy of the seven he had against the 76ers on July 15, as he finishes the Las Vegas Summer League on a high note.

Wizards' Dillon Jones: Double-doubles in SL finale
Jones racked up 25 points (8-13 FG, 2-3 3Pt, 7-9 FT), 11 rebounds, three assists, two steals and one block across 36 minutes during Saturday's 94-85 Summer League win against the Knicks.
Jones finished his stint in the Las Vegas Summer League on a high note, with game highs in points and rebounds. The Thunder recently traded the Weber State product to the Wizards on June 28, and he'll hope to carve out a role with his new team during the 2025-26 campaign.

Wizards' AJ Johnson: Another big game in SL
Johnson generated 25 points (10-16 FG, 2-5 3Pt, 3-5 FT), with five rebounds and three assists over 35 minutes of Wednesday's 86-76 Summer League loss to Utah.
Johnson dropped 20 points Tuesday and followed up the performance with a Summer-League high in the category. Entering his second NBA season, Johnson will have a tough time cracking the Wizards' rotation, but at age 20, he has shown plenty of promise as a long-term project.

Wizards' Leaky Black: Records SL double-double
Black contributed 10 points (3-9 FG, 1-3 3Pt, 3-5 FT), 11 rebounds, four assists, four blocks and two steals over 33 minutes in Wednesday's 86-76 Summer League loss to the Jazz.
Black didn't shoot particularly well Wednesday but filled up the stat sheet, most notably grabbing 11 rebounds and swatting four shots. He spent the 2024-25 season with the Wizards' G League affiliate, the Capital City Go-Go, and hasn't appeared in an NBA regular-season game since suiting up for the Hornets during the 2023-24 campaign.

Wizards' Jamir Watkins: Records seven swipes in SL loss
Watkins contributed 10 points (4-16 FG, 1-7 3Pt, 1-2 FT), seven steals, five rebounds, three blocks and two assists across 32 minutes in Tuesday's 74-58 Summer League loss to the 76ers.
Watkins struggled with efficiency on offense but made a major impact defensively, racking up eight steals and three blocks. The wing was taken No. 43 overall in the 2025 NBA Draft after a strong season at Florida State, where he averaged 18.4 points, 5.7 rebounds, 2.4 assists and 1.2 steals across 32 games.

Wizards' AJ Johnson: Scores 20 in SL loss
Johnson recorded 20 points (7-20 FG, 1-7 3Pt, 5-5 FT), five rebounds, one assist and one steal over 31 minutes in Tuesday's 74-58 Summer League loss to the 76ers.
Johnson struggled from beyond the arc but still led the Wizards with 20 points in Tuesday's loss. Acquired in February in the trade that sent Kyle Kuzma to the Bucks, the young guard will look to earn a spot in a crowded backcourt that now includes CJ McCollum, Tre Johnson and others.

Wizards' Alex Sarr: Logs near triple-double in SL
Sarr recorded 16 points (7-15 FG, 0-2 3Pt, 2-4 FT), 12 rebounds, eight blocks and two assists in 29 minutes during Sunday's 102-96 Summer League win over the Nets.
Sarr dominated the paint Sunday, posting a game-high 12 rebounds, including four on the offensive glass and a game-high eight blocks. Sarr was a quality shot blocker during his rookie season, averaging 1.5 blocks per contest, and he has been impressive in that category thus far at Summer League, logging 11 blocks through two games.

Wizards' Kyshawn George: Stuffs stat sheet in SL win
George recorded 10 points (4-16 FG, 1-8 3Pt, 1-2 FT), nine rebounds, six assists and five steals in 31 minutes during Sunday's 102-96 Summer League win over the Nets.
George put together a solid all-around performance Sunday, posting a game-high in steals while matching a game-high in assists. George also did well on the glass, grabbing nine rebounds. While he put together an impressive stat line, he struggled to score efficiently, logging 10 points on 25 percent from the floor.
